OBITUARY
Dixie Bogacki, 70, of Ogallala, died Saturday, October 9, 2010 in Premier
Estates of North Platte, NE.
Dixie Lee Bogacki was born February 21, 1940 in St. Joseph, Missouri, the
daughter of Eugene and Marsene Hart Akins. As a young child she moved to
Torrance, Cal. with her family. In 1958 she graduated from Torrance High School.
On June 19, 1959 Dixie married Richard J. Bogacki in Torrance where the couple
made their home. She worked at Teledyne and Hughes Aircraft. Dixie was also
employed as an electronic technician in the aero space industry for several
years. In the late 1980's Richard and Dixie managed several hotels in the Culver
City area.
In 1994 Dixie moved to Ogallala and was employed part time at the Sutherland
Power Plant. She retired in 2005. Dixie moved to Premier Estates in North Platte
in 2009 due to health problems.
Her hobbies included spending time with her children and grandchildren, reading,
crafts, knitting, and traveling.
Preceding her in death was her husband Richard Bogacki, her parents, brother
Eugene Akins, sister Rosie Baker, one grandchild Kimberly Bruce, and one
great-grandchild Chance Bogacki.
Survivors include two daughters Sandra and her husband Tim Bruce and Teri Wogan,
all of Ogallala. three sons Chester Bogacki of Central City; Joseph Bogacki of
Ravenna; and Leroy Bogacki of North Platte. one brother Jim Akins and his wife
Connie of Keystone; one sister Gwendolyn Forresh of San Pedro, Cal. Ten
Grandchildren and four Great-grandchildren.
Cremation was chosen and there will be no viewing. The Memorial Service will be
Wednesday, Oct. 13, at 10 a.m. in Draucker Funeral Home. Rev. Eric Wait of New
Hope Church will officiate. A memorial has been established in her memory.
Inurnment will take place in Torrance, Cal., at a later date.
